|
2. Business Acquisition and Contingent Consideration: Schedule of Business Acquisitions by Acquisition, Contingent Consideration (Details) - USD ($)
|12 Months Ended
|
Mar. 31, 2017
|
Mar. 31, 2016
|
Mar. 31, 2015
|
Mar. 31, 2017
|
Mar. 31, 2016
|Payable to Corporation
|$ 1,257,995
|[1]
|$ 831,632
|$ 409,861
|Business Combination, Contingent Consideration, Liability
|758,953
|1,031,179
|1,172,654
|Business Combination, Liabilities Arising from Contingencies, Amount Recognized
|2,016,948
|1,862,811
|1,582,515
|Loss on change in fair value of contingent consideration
|83,189
|154,137
|280,296
|Business Combination, Contingent Consideration Arrangements, Change in Amount of Contingent Consideration, Liability
|(295,191)
|(272,226)
|(141,475)
|Fair Value, Measured on Recurring Basis, Gain (Loss) Included in Earnings
|83,189
|154,137
|280,296
|Payable to Corporation
|1,257,995
|[1]
|831,632
|409,861
|$ 1,636,365
|[1]
|$ 1,257,995
|[1]
|Business Combination, Contingent Consideration, Liability
|758,953
|1,031,179
|1,172,654
|463,772
|758,953
|Business Combination, Liabilities Arising from Contingencies, Amount Recognized
|2,016,948
|1,862,811
|1,582,515
|2,105,137
|2,016,948
|Payable to Corporation
|1,636,365
|[1]
|1,257,995
|[1]
|831,632
|Business Combination, Contingent Consideration, Liability
|463,772
|758,953
|1,031,179
|Business Combination, Liabilities Arising from Contingencies, Amount Recognized
|2,105,137
|2,016,948
|1,862,811
|Contingent consideration, current portion
|339,080
|461,211
|Contingent consideration
|124,692
|$ 297,742
|Accounts Payable
|Loss on change in fair value of contingent consideration
|378,370
|$ 426,363
|$ 421,771
|Boston Scientific Corp.
|Payable to Corporation
|1,636,365
|$ 1,636,365
|Payable to Corporation
|$ 1,636,365
|X
- Definition
+ References
Amount of increase (decrease) in the value of a contingent consideration liability, including, but not limited to, differences arising upon settlement.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Amount of liability recognized arising from contingent consideration in a business combination.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Amount of liability recognized arising from contingent consideration in a business combination, expected to be settled within one year or the normal operating cycle, if longer.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Amount of liability recognized arising from contingent consideration in a business combination, expected to be settled beyond one year or the normal operating cycle, if longer.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
The amount, measured at acquisition-date fair value, of all liabilities assumed that arise from contingencies and were recognized by the entity.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Amount of realized and unrealized gain (loss) included in earnings, which have arisen from the use of significant unobservable inputs (level 3) to measure fair value of assets, liabilities, and financial instruments classified in shareholders' equity.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Amount of gain (loss) recognized on the income statement for financial instrument classified as a liability measured using unobservable inputs that reflect the entity's own assumption about the assumptions market participants would use in pricing.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Amount of borrowings from a creditor other than a bank with a maturity within one year or operating cycle, if longer.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Details
|X
- Details